今天我无法将二进制文件提交到App Store,错误“二进制文件无效,二进制文件缺少架构[arm64]”。
但是在“构建设置” - >“架构”中,它确实有arm64。
以前的版本可以成功提交,我还没有修改项目设置。
答案 0 :(得分:3)
正如蒂姆在这篇帖子中所说:https://devforums.apple.com/thread/244448,这显然是一个错误。 但是,它还没有解决......
发布图片的声誉不够,请搜索" TimT"他的回复。
<强>更新强>
它已被修复。 &#34;是的,最近有一个修复程序应用于服务器。每个人都应该能够再次提交32位应用程序。&#34; - TimT在同一个帖子中。我再次尝试,一切都很好。
答案 1 :(得分:1)
经过长时间的尝试并尝试解决此问题后,我没有任何解决方案,而是安装旧版本的Xcode 5.0.2并使用该版本提交二进制文件。
干杯:)
答案 2 :(得分:0)
我早上有同样的错误,显然它是第三方库/框架之一,它缺少架构[arm64]。
答案 3 :(得分:0)
似乎app现在必须支持arm64。
在我的情况下,我使用了一些不支持arm64的第三方库。
我删除了库,现在就可以了。
架构设置如下所示: